You will be updated with latest job alerts via emailThis position operates under general supervision and is tasked with independently carrying out both routine and intricate maintenance and repair tasks on ski area equipment and structures. The role includes leadership responsibilities such as delegating daily tasks training staff providing guidance and reviewing the work of junior Mechanics. Additionally the incumbent may make decisions regarding maintenance or repairs in the absence of the Lift and Vehicle Maintenance Manager and the Director of Mountain Operations. Eaglecrest boasts a diverse range of heavy machinery including Excavators dump trucks road graders snowcats snowmobiles and 4wheelers offering extensive exposure to various equipment. The majority of our machinery is nontier 4 with the exception of our 2018 Pisten Bully 400 winch cat. Eaglecrest features three Riblet double chairlifts one Hall double chair and is in the process of installing a Doppelmayr fixedgrip pulsing Gondola.
